Before attempting to disable the alarm system, it is important to follow some safety precautions to avoid any accidents or damage to the system. Make sure to disconnect the power supply to the alarm system before working on any wiring. This can be done by turning off the main power switch or unplugging the system from the electrical outlet.
Once the power is disconnected, carefully review the disabled alarm wiring diagram to locate the components that need to be disabled. Common components that are often disconnected include the control panel, sensors, sirens, and backup batteries. Each component may have specific wires that need to be disconnected to disable the system properly.
For example, to disable the control panel, locate the main power wire and disconnect it from the power source. This will cut off the power supply to the control panel, rendering it inactive. Similarly, for sensors and sirens, look for the wires connecting these components to the control panel and disconnect them accordingly. Backup batteries can be removed from their respective compartments to disable the system completely.
It is crucial to follow the disabled alarm wiring diagram accurately to ensure that the alarm system is disabled properly. Failure to do so can result in the system continuing to function or causing damage to the system. If homeowners are unsure about how to disable their alarm system, it is recommended to seek help from a professional technician to avoid any mishaps.
